Abstract

This paper presents an Adaptive Rate Control Framework, which performs proactive rate control based on packet loss prediction and on-line audio quality assessment for real-time packet audio. The proposed framework determines the optimal combination of various audio codecs for transmission, utilizing a thorough analysis of audio quality based on individual codec characteristics, as opposed to ad-hoc codec redundancy used by other approaches. As a main component of this frame-work, this paper shows a preliminary formulation of the Packet Loss Predictor, that determines the likelihood of packet loss in terms of available bandwidth, delay variation trend, and network history. We present simulation and experiment results to show the accuracy and efficiency of this technique.
